Output 8e96aa0706322526fce5b39eaa9a794eeb54e28f34219d9421dbd7c5d7478c7b:0

value
4068092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bf848290b12c14066a15bcb61b0ef74639d48a2 OP_EQUALVERIFY OP_CHECKSIG
address
151VVBCjGvzUwAhJJXqdxgyj4P13ZznwdQ
transaction
8e96aa0706322526fce5b39eaa9a794eeb54e28f34219d9421dbd7c5d7478c7b
spent
true